Everything I have read says to apply weed killer after washing the block paving and before sanding but all weed killers I know say to apply to the leaves and it will then kill the roots.

Surely it would be better to spray the weed killer then wait a week and then wash rather than wash then weed kill?

I take it that it is the time factor that stops people sprays a week in advance?

I am thinking about not using weed killer if I can't spray at least a week in advance.

Am I missing something here?

I always apply hypo after I clean as well

So most of the weeds have disappeared from the joints a t this point

This allows the hypo to soak down between any joints and will defiantly kill of any little roots left

I no it's sad but I actually tested hypo on some living weeds in my border lol then dug them up 2 days later to inspect the roots

One word!cremated!!

 
Glyphosate is readily available and is what is used at allotments etc to clear overgrown unnatended plots as it kills the weeds but becomes inert once it comes in contact with the ground so you can then dig over the plot ready for use

Glyphosate is the active ingredient in a lot of over the counter weedkillers and readily available from from most garden sections of the likes of B&Q etc, it does need a leaf to get down to the roots though but I just put in my aftercare leaflet that any recurrence of weeds is to be treated by the customer as they can and will seed in the joints if it isnt sealed, no way of avoiding it really. Never make wild promises that it'll stay weed free for any period of time as it wont happen and you'll get call backs, just arm them with the information to maintain thier drive/paved area once your finished and they've no comeback
